Firefly Aerospace Inc (NASDAQ: FLY) shares increased by 7.41% to $30.58 on Wednesday, driven by optimism surrounding NASA's Artemis II launch and the potential for future lunar funding. The company's recent fourth-quarter revenue of $57.67 million exceeded estimates of $52.35 million, contributing to positive market sentiment. Additionally, Firefly's Blue Ghost lunar lander and Commercial Lunar Payload Services align closely with NASA's Artemis goals, enhancing its position in the commercial space sector.
